Anthocyanins and antioxidant activity of fruits certain representatives of genus Rubus

In the conditions of the Republic of Belarus there was realized identification of anthocyanins, estimation of their total content in blackberry (Rubus fruticosus L., Rubus caesius L. and Rubus nessensis W. Hall.) and raspberry \{Rubus idaeus L.) as well as the evaluation of fruit antioxidant activity. A total of 17 anthocyanins were detected and identified by HPLC-MS analysis. The aglvcon forms were represented by five anthocyanidins: cyanidin, delphinidin, pelargonidin, petunidin and malvidin. The prevalent sugar moieties were glucose, galactose, arabinose, rutinose, sophorose and sambubiose. Significant differences between the qualitative composition of anthocyanins have been detected in examined fruits. Total anthocyanins ranged (in mg cyanidin 3-O-glucoside per 100 g of fresh weight) from 95.72 to 538.48. Mean values of antioxidant capacity by ABTS and ORAC methods (in mmol Trolox equivalent per 100 g of fresh weight) were 3.41-8.17 and 2.26-4.77 respectively. Mean FRAP values varied from 5.35 to 10.67 mmol Fe2 +/100 g FW of fruits. On the based of our data the recommendations on practical application of fruits were proposed.
